# Cleaning Crew Access

Brightmop crew works the Larkspur Annex Mon–Fri, 18:00–21:00. They enter via the rear stairwell only. Supervisor signs the log at the service desk each visit. Cart storage: room B04, keep clear. Escalate missed visits to facilities next morning. The stairwell keypad accepts the standard crew code listed below.

door code, yagap-bahof: bdg-O-05

Completed: product-line margins for the Kestrel and Bramley ranges, rebased to current freight rates. Outstanding: the Norwick warehouse allocation model and supplier rebate reconciliation with Tallowgate Goods. Flag: blended margin on Bramley is 2.3 points below plan, mostly packaging costs. Finance team has the working files; keep version control tight. Decision needed from you on whether to restate prior-quarter comparatives. Before the board session, read the confidential planning note appended directly below.

internal memo for hahaf-bajef: Headcount on the Zorael team goes from 7 to 140 by the end of July. Gross margin on Zorael came in at 15 percent against a plan of 15 percent.

## Step 4: Swap the ORM adapter

New to the Cobblewick team? This step replaces the legacy Thornquist ORM layer with the new adapter. Remove the old mapper import, point your models at the adapter registry, and run the schema check. Don't migrate data yet — that's step 6. The adapter expects the configuration values shown below.

config for yajep-tafof:
[rusath]
team = julmir
access_code = ac_fe37fd
host = rusath.novactech.test
port = 8000
owner = pelmir.weneth
peer = oliwyn.olvarqdyn.internal